Imagine being locked in a room with a complete stranger. Would you survive? For Oakley and Holland, the idea of having to share a room with someone they don’t know becomes a reality.Both are on a venture to escape their worlds, attempting to leave behind everything negative. Along the way, paths are crossed, introducing the idea of building together. Before they get too far off the ground, secrets and truths are exposed, showing just what they’re fleeing.While seemingly locked away from the world, they not only have to face their own demons, but that of the other as well. Knowing the truth about Oakley, will Holland continue to pursue her? After finding out just what Holland is hiding, can Oakley look past it, considering her own past?

Rating 3.5⭐️ This story said “forced proximity” and then cranked the tension all the way up. Two strangers, one room, a storm raging outside, big ass egos and nowhere to hide from themselves or each other. What starts as survival mode slowly turns into connection and watching that shift felt equal parts intimate and unsettling in the best way.
The twists caught me off guard, especially how quickly feelings escalated. That close quarters pressure, mixed with vulnerability and chemistry, had emotions moving faster than logic. When those “I love yous” dropped I literally froze. Shocked but not mad at it. It felt reckless, impulsive and very human. I really wanted to blame it on the alcohol.
What really worked was how neither of them was clean or uncomplicated. Secrets came out swinging and the question wasn’t just can they love each other but can they accept the parts each of them is trying to escape. Facing your own demons is hard. Facing someone else’s is a whole different test.
Holland 😒 yeah that man learned a hard lesson. Playing in the snow always looks fun until you realize how cold it really is. DANGEROUS! This was messy, intense, unexpected and addictive. The kind of story that locks you in right along with them and doesn’t let you out untouched.

I don't mind insta-love stories, but this one didn't do it for me. Holland and Oakley were both a bit on the hostile side. I would not have been sharing a room with him because she had every right to question his motives. She didn't know him from a can of peas!🙄 And if he was offering, he could have been a bit nicer to put her at ease. Holland's backstory was interesting, however, I wish it been fleshed out a bit more. And Oakley had an interesting reason for fleeing the way she did too, but not enough focus on that.
The plot was a nice idea for a novella. However, the descriptive storytelling was lacking. Not enough details were offered to convey how attractive the characters were to each other. It was difficult for me to visualize several scenes in the story. I replayed the elevator scene because it was a glass elevator that allowed you to see the outside storm…and there was sexual activity inside this elevator. This was my first read by this author. Not sure if it was her first writing, but there is potential.
